Fabricated from AISI 304 grade stainless steel, it exhibits superior resistance to a wide range of corrosive environments due to its balanced austenitic structure, containing a minimum of 18% chromium and 8% nickel. This material's excellent weldability and formability allow for intricate designs and robust structural integrity, ensuring reliability in critical applications.

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using incompatible welding consumables for 304 stainless steel. | Employ filler metals specifically designed for 304 stainless steel to maintain corrosion resistance and mechanical properties. |
| Allowing carbon steel contamination during handling or processing. | Implement strict segregation protocols and use dedicated tools and work surfaces to prevent cross-contamination, which can lead to rust. |
